Question 1

Which of the following is not an endocrine gland?

  1. Mammary gland
  2. Hypothalamus
  3. Pituitary
  4. Adrenal gland
Explanation: Endocrine glands secrete hormones into the blood stream, lined with endothelium, allowing them to travel through the blood and to act at a distant site. Exocrine organs, in contrast, secrete products into lumens that are lined with epithelium. Mammary glands are used in lactation. Because the milk is not secreted into the blood, the mammary glands are not endocrine glands. The hypothalamus releases hormones into the blood, such as corticotropin-releasing hormone (CRH). The pituitary releases hormones such as prolactin. The adrenal gland secretes hormones such as cortisol.
